Freestyle Trap Beats A Subgenre Within Freestyle

Now, within the realm of freestyle beats, there is a particular subset called freestyle trap beat. Trap music, originating from the southern United States, is characterized by very heavy use 808 bass drums, quick hi-hat patterns, and dark, moody melodies. It's a noise that has actually grown in popularity for many years, turning into one of the most influential categories in modern rap.

Freestyle trap beats take these trademark facets and fuse them with the freedom and flexibility of freestyle beats, resulting in a highly effective blending. These beats are best for artists looking to bring power and aggressiveness to their verses while still maintaining the liberty to discover different circulations and styles.

What Is a Free Type Beat?

A free type beat is an instrumental that music producers give free of charge use, typically for non-commercial objectives. While the beats can be utilized for demos, freestyles, and social networks material, musicians typically need to pay for a permit if they intend to launch the song readily (i.e., on streaming systems or for sale).

This version has actually been a game-changer, allowing young artists to trying out their sound, exercise their freestyling, and build an internet visibility without having to fret about manufacturing expenses.
